A comparator is an electronic circuit that compares two analog input signals, so based on a comparison, it generates an output [49]. Comparators are devices that compare two voltages or currents and output a digital signal indicating which is larger. Inputs analog signals and outputs a digital signal. In digital electronics, a comparator is a combinational logic circuit that is used to compare the magnitudes of two binary. The output value of the comparator indicates which of. After operational amplifiers (op amps), comparators are the most generally used analog, simple integrated circuits.
